首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

自动筛选日期(英国格式)数组问题

自动筛选日期(英国格式)数组问题是指如何根据英国日期格式对一个数组中的日期进行自动筛选的问题。

答案: 要解决自动筛选日期(英国格式)数组的问题,可以采取以下步骤:

  1. 遍历数组:使用编程语言中的循环结构,如for循环或者foreach循环,对数组中的每个元素进行遍历。
  2. 日期格式转换:将数组中的日期字符串按照英国日期格式进行转换,一般为“dd/mm/yyyy”格式。
  3. 条件判断:使用条件语句,判断转换后的日期是否符合筛选条件。可以根据需要设置筛选条件,例如选择在指定日期范围内的日期,或者选择特定月份的日期。
  4. 结果存储:将符合筛选条件的日期存储到一个新的数组或者列表中,用于后续的处理或展示。

下面是一个示例代码片段,演示如何使用Python语言实现自动筛选日期(英国格式)数组的功能:

代码语言:txt
复制
import datetime

def filter_dates(date_array, start_date, end_date):
    filtered_dates = []
    for date_str in date_array:
        date = datetime.datetime.strptime(date_str, "%d/%m/%Y")
        if start_date <= date <= end_date:
            filtered_dates.append(date_str)
    return filtered_dates

# 示例数据
date_array = ["01/02/2023", "15/03/2023", "10/04/2023", "25/05/2023"]
start_date = datetime.datetime(2023, 3, 1)
end_date = datetime.datetime(2023, 5, 31)

filtered_dates = filter_dates(date_array, start_date, end_date)
print(filtered_dates)

在这个示例中,filter_dates函数接受一个日期数组 date_array,一个开始日期 start_date 和一个结束日期 end_date 作为参数。函数会遍历日期数组中的每个日期,将符合日期范围内的日期存储到 filtered_dates 数组中,并最终打印出来。

这个示例代码中使用了Python的datetime库来处理日期转换和比较,其他编程语言也会有类似的日期处理库。这个示例只是一个简单的演示,实际情况下,可能还需要根据具体需求进行更复杂的条件判断和数据处理。

腾讯云相关产品推荐:腾讯云提供了多种云计算相关产品,其中包括服务器、数据库、人工智能等领域的解决方案。可以参考以下腾讯云产品和产品介绍链接地址:

  1. 云服务器(CVM):提供基于云的虚拟服务器实例,可以灵活配置和管理服务器资源。产品介绍链接:云服务器(CVM)
  2. 云数据库MySQL版:提供高可用、弹性扩展的云数据库服务,适用于各种规模的应用场景。产品介绍链接:云数据库MySQL版
  3. 腾讯AI开放平台:提供各类人工智能API和SDK,包括图像识别、自然语言处理、语音识别等功能。产品介绍链接:腾讯AI开放平台

请注意,以上只是一些腾讯云的产品示例,实际选择产品时应根据具体需求和场景进行评估和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 谁将成为无人驾驶的“车下亡魂”?

    在人工智能时代,每一个关于道德的问题似乎都在引发另一个问题。利兹培根教授是英国格林尼治大学建筑、计算和人文学科的副校长,她还拥有人工智能博士学位,是英国计算机协会的前任主席。上周在墨尔本举行的国际人工智能联合会议上培根教授表示,那些关于AI的法律的辩论仍面临着大量复杂的问题亟待解决。 在汽车中输入的程序需要取代人类在同样情况下所做的思考。“现在作为一名司机,你必须做出一个瞬间的决定,但对于自动驾驶汽车,你必须通过编程来判断其后果。”在没有选择的情况下,你会怎么做? “你可以直接用数字来解决。”汽车可能会说,

    010

    数据处理的R包

    整理数据的本质可以归纳为:对数据进行分割(Split),然后应用(Apply)某些处理函数,最后将结果重新组合(Combine)成所需的格式返回,简单描述为:Split - Apply - Combine。plyr包是Hadley Wickham为解决split – apply – combine问题而写的一个包。使用plyr包可以针对不同的数据类型,在一个函数内同时完成split – apply – combine三个步骤。plyr包的主函数是**ply形式的,函数名的第一个字符代表输入数据的类型,第二个字符代表输出数据的类型,其中第一个字符可以是(d、l、a),第二个字母可以是(d、l、a、_ ),不同的字母表示不同的数据格式,d表示数据框格式,l表示列表,a表示数组,_则表示没有输出。

    02
    领券